Macronutrient concentrations and amounts in the animal excreta on mombaça grass pasture, fertilized with different phosphorus sources

The objective of this experiment was to evalute the effects of phosphorus sources (Yoorin®, Ordinary Superphosphate (SS) + Triple Superphosphate (TS) and control) on the concentration and amount of N, P, K, and Ca in the excreta of crossbred steers under grazing conditions on mombaça grass (Panicum maximum Jacq. cv. mombaça) pasture. The grazing method was the continuous stocking with variable stocking rate, and the animals used were crossbred with average live weight of 300 kg. It was used a complete randomized design in split plot with four replications. Urine production and K concentration were high for animals grazing on Yoorin fertilized pastures compared to other treatments; urine production ranged from 7.2 to 20.4 L/animal/day and K urine concentration ranged from 180 to 310 g/L. Animals grazing on the control and SS + TS treatments presented greater N and P urine concentration than the ones grazing on Yoorin fertilized pastures, ranging from 154 to 195 g N/L and 0.2 to 0.29 g P/L, respectively. Average N and K amount excreted via urine was greater for animals grazing on Yoorin and SS + TS treatments compared to control treatment, ranging from 51 to 99 g N/animal/dia and 46 to 49 g K/animal/dia, respectively. Average Ca concentration and P and Ca amount excreted via urine were similar among treatments. Average fecal production and N, K, Ca concentrations and amounts were similar among treatments. Average P amount was greater for SS + TS and Yoorin treatments compared to the control, ranging from 7.5 to 11.6 g P/animal/day. Nutrient return via animal excreta contributed in the experimental period with 73, 87, 6, and 28 kg/ha of N, K, P, and Ca, respectively. Animals on Yoorin fertilized pastures presented greater urine production and greater K urine concentration and amount.
